Introduction

AI Translation

The ATtiny202/402 are members of the tinyAVR 0-series of microcontrollers, using the AVR processor with hardware multiplier, running at up to 20 MHz, with 2/4 KB Flash, 128/256 bytes of SRAM, and 64/128 bytes of EEPROM in an 8-pin package. The tinyAVR 0-series uses the latest technologies with a flexible, low-power architecture including Event System and SleepWalking, accurate analog features, and Core Independent Peripherals.

Features

AI Translation
  • CPU:
    • AVR CPU
    • Running at up to 20 MHz Single-cycle I/O access
    • Two-level interrupt controller
    • Two-cycle hardware multiplier
  • Memories:
    • 2/4 KB In-system self-programmable Flash memory
    • 64/128B EEPROM
    • 128/256B SRAM
    • Write/erase endurance:
      • Flash: 10,000 cycles
      • EEPROM: 100,000 cycles
    • Data retention: 40 years at 55℃
  • System:
    • Power-on Reset (POR)
    • Brown-out Detector (BOD)
    • Clock Options:
      • 16/20 MHz low-power internal RC oscillator
      • 32.768 kHz Ultra Low-Power (ULP) internal RC oscillator
      • External clock input
    • Single-pin Unified Program and Debug Interface (UPDI)
  • Three sleep modes:
    • Idle with all peripherals running for immediate wake-up
    • Standby – Configurable operation of selected peripherals – SleepWalking peripherals
    • Power-Down with full data retention
  • One Analog Comparator (AC) with a low propagation delay
  • One 10-bit 115 ksps Analog-to-Digital Converter (ADC)
  • Multiple voltage references (VREF):
    • 0.55V
    • 1.1V
    • 1.5V
    • 2.5V
    • 4.3V
  • Event System (EVSYS) for CPU independent and predictable inter-peripheral signaling
  • Configurable Custom Logic (CCL) with two programmable look-up tables
  • Automated CRC memory scan (CRCSCAN)
  • External interrupt on all general purpose pins
  • I/O and Packages:
    • Six programmable I/O lines
    • 8-pin SOIC150
  • Temperature Ranges: -40℃ to 105℃, -40℃ to 125℃
  • Speed Grades:
    • 0 - 5 MHz @ 1.8V – 5.5V
    • 0 - 10 MHz @ 2.7V - 5.5V
    • 0 - 20 MHz @ 4.5V – 5.5V
